PowerShell Exchange

Open-source PowerShell projects categorized as Exchange

Top 12 PowerShell Exchange Projects

  • AutomatedLab

    AutomatedLab is a provisioning solution and framework that lets you deploy complex labs on HyperV and Azure with simple PowerShell scripts. It supports all Windows operating systems from 2008 R2 to 2022, some Linux distributions and various products like AD, Exchange, PKI, IIS, etc.

  • Set-OutlookSignatures

    The open source gold standard to centrally manage and deploy email signatures and out-of-office replies for Outlook and Exchange

  • Project mention: ISO - Application to standardize and control email signatures | /r/sysadmin | 2023-12-08

    Set-OutlookSignatures might be what your are looking for: https://github.com/Set-OutlookSignatures/Set-OutlookSignatures

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

    InfluxDB logo
  • PowerShell-AdminScripts

    PowerShell Administration scripts

  • AdminToolbox

    Repository for the AdminToolbox PowerShell Modules

  • Connect-Office365Services

    Helper functions to connect to Office 365 services or Exchange On-Premises.

  • EWS-Office365-Contact-Sync

    Uses Exchange Web Services to synchronize a Global Address List in Office 365 to a user's mailbox

  • Remove-DuplicateItems

    Script to remove duplicate items from Exchange mailboxes.

  • Project mention: Outlook de-duplicating tools | /r/sysadmin | 2023-06-07
  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  • Export-RecipientPermissions

    Document, filter and compare Exchange permissions: Mailbox access rights, mailbox folder permissions, public folder permissions, send as, send on behalf, managed by, moderated by, linked master accounts, forwarders, sender restrictions, resource delegates, group members, management role group members

  • O365Synchronizer

    O365Synchronizer is a PowerShell module that allows you to synchronize users/contacts to user mailboxes contact list. It can also be used to synchronize users between tenants as contacts or guests.

  • Project mention: [PowerShell] O365Synchronizer - module to synchronize contacts to user mailboxes and between O365 tenants | /r/usefulscripts | 2023-12-04
  • ewsgui

    Exchange Web Services (EWS) tool to perform different operations

  • Exchange-15-GEC

    Customization of michelderooij's Install-Exchange15 Script to recover a nuked Exchange Server after Hafnium attack.

  • Microsoft-Exchange-Memory-Limits

    PowerShell script to place limits on the memory usage of Microsoft Exchange Servers.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

PowerShell Exchange related posts

  • [PowerShell] O365Synchronizer - module to synchronize contacts to user mailboxes and between O365 tenants

    1 project | /r/usefulscripts | 4 Dec 2023
  • O365Synchronizer - PowerShell module to synchronize contacts to user mailboxes and between O365 tenants

    1 project | /r/Office365 | 4 Dec 2023
  • Exchange databases Grow after every reindex

    1 project | /r/exchangeserver | 31 Oct 2022
  • Daily Maintenance Exchange 2016?

    1 project | /r/exchangeserver | 26 Jun 2022
  • Script to document existing but unknown Exchange environmentb

    1 project | /r/exchangeserver | 2 Feb 2022
  • How to sync Gal users with personal contacts

    1 project | /r/Office365 | 15 Dec 2021
  • Calculating Exchange Server growth (mailboxes, databases)?

    1 project | /r/exchangeserver | 10 Sep 2021
  • A note from our sponsor - InfluxDB
    www.influxdata.com | 17 May 2024
    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ality. Learn more →

Index

What are some of the best open-source Exchange projects in PowerShell? This list will help you:

Project Stars
1 AutomatedLab 1,947
2 Set-OutlookSignatures 277
3 PowerShell-AdminScripts 191
4 AdminToolbox 177
5 Connect-Office365Services 94
6 EWS-Office365-Contact-Sync 92
7 Remove-DuplicateItems 45
8 Export-RecipientPermissions 16
9 O365Synchronizer 15
10 ewsgui 9
11 Exchange-15-GEC 2
12 Microsoft-Exchange-Memory-Limits 0

Sponsored
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com